PROGRAM DESIGN
|
||
CUMBERLAND PLATEAU REGIONAL OPPORTUNITY PROGRAM (CProp)
|
||
|
||
PURPOSE
|
||
|
||
The Cumberland Plateau Regional Opportunity Program (CProp) is established to
|
||
reinvest program income revenues from the CPC Broadband project in economic development
|
||
efforts in the four counties and twelve towns of the Cumberland Plateau Planning District
|
||
(CPPDC). These program income revenues are generated from the regional broadband
|
||
infrastructure system that was funded by the U.S. Economic Development Administration, the
|
||
Virginia Tobacco Commission, U.S. National Telecommunications and Information
|
||
Administration and the Virginia Coalfield Economic Development Authority and is operated and
|
||
maintained by the Cumberland Plateau Company in partnership with the Sunset Group,
|
||
specifically Point Broadband.
|
||
|
||
ELIGIBLE APPLICANTS AND ACTIVITIES
|
||
|
||
The only eligible applicants for CProp funds are the local governing bodies of the
|
||
Cumberland Plateau Planning District Commission – Buchanan, Dickenson, Russell and
|
||
Tazewell Counties and the Towns of Grundy, Clinchco, Clintwood, Haysi, Cleveland, Honaker,
|
||
Lebanon, Bluefield, Cedar Bluff, Pocahontas, Richlands and Tazewell.
|
||
|
||
The CProp is meant to be a flexible grant source for these local governments to support
|
||
various public economic and community development activities that help to diversify the District
|
||
economy. Preference will be given to activities that are linked to the Cumberland Plateau
|
||
Planning District Commission’s Comprehensive Economic Development Strategy (latest update)
|
||
and to other regional, state and federal economic development plans, initiatives and programs.
|
||
Eligible activities include, but are not limited to, the following:
|
||
|
||
• Industrial Site/Park Development Projects in support of manufacturing jobs,
|
||
including, but not limited to, infrastructure activities such as water, sewer,
|
||
telecommunications, electricity, natural gas, access roads, rails sidings, etc.
|
||
|
||
• Broadband and Wireless Infrastructure Expansion and Upgrade projects that
|
||
support business development and expansion as well as deployment in residential
|
||
communities.
|
||
|
||
• Downtown Revitalization Projects, including, but not limited to, activities such as
|
||
streetscapes, signage, building renovations, water and sewer and other public
|
||
infrastructure improvements, etc. that support or enhance small business
|
||
development. CProp funds cannot be used for renovations to public buildings
|
||
and facilities that do not have an economic development impact.

• Asset-based Development Projects, such as trails, trailheads, welcome centers,
|
||
museums, and other tourism-related activities that support new business
|
||
development related to the regional cultural heritage and outdoor recreation
|
||
initiatives such as Southwest Virginia Outdoors, The Crooked Road, ‘Round the
|
||
Mountain, the Clinch River Valley Initiative and the Spearhead Trails.
|
||
|
||
• Other activities that support economic diversification in the region as determined
|
||
by the Cumberland Plateau Company Board and in keeping with the District
|
||
CEDS and the guidelines of the U.S. Economic Development Administration.
|
||
|
||
APPLICATION PROCESS
|
||
|
||
Applications for CProp funds will be received each quarter of the fiscal year on the
|
||
following dates: January 15, April 15, July 15 and October 15. Upon receipt of applications, the
|
||
Cumberland Plateau Company Executive Board (Board) will review and make awards as
|
||
appropriate within the CProp guidelines as approved by EDA at the regular Executive Board
|
||
Meeting the following month. Only one (1) application from a locality can be received in a year
|
||
unless the Board directs otherwise.
|
||
|
||
APPLICATION GUIDELINES
|
||
|
||
CProp funds, as available, are to be used for economic and community development and
|
||
economic enhancement activities in the four counties of the Cumberland Plateau Planning
|
||
District. Higher priority will be given to projects that support job creation. However, projects
|
||
that have lower job creation numbers but enhance overall economic development efforts, such as
|
||
asset-based or downtown projects, will be eligible for funding.
|
||
|
||
A maximum of $200,000 will be available for any one project in any given year, unless
|
||
the Board directs otherwise. It is anticipated that larger funding awards may be made for projects
|
||
with large numbers of jobs created.
